It is believed that a video has appeared in Kuala Lumpur with a man claiming to be the son of the murdered North Korean believed to be Kim Jong Nam
A group called Cheollima Civil Defense on the YouTube page uploaded a video titled KHS Video on 7/3/2017. The man in the video says: “My name is Kim Han Sol, from North Korea, part of the Kim family.
My father has been killed a few days ago. I’m currently with my mother and my sister. We are very grateful to …, with that the audio cuts off and with him signing off saying he hope that things would get better soon.
As a proof of his identity in the 40 second video, the man show his passport but leaving out his particulars.
Do Hee Youn, an activist with the Citizens Coalition for Human Rights of Abductees and North Korean Refugees confirmed that the man in the video is Kim Han Sol.
The group’s website where the video was also posted on said it was taking care of Kim Jong Nam family.
An emergency request by survivors of the family of Kim Jong Nam for extraction and protection was responded promptly by “Cheollima Civil Defense”.
